1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is happening to the size of the Atlantic Ocean?
Back
It is getting wider as the plates divide.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Why are earthquakes mostly located at plate boundaries?
Back
Because tectonic plates interact at these boundaries, leading to seismic activity.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What do the pink stripes closest to the center of the ocean ridge represent?
Back
They represent normal polarity, are made of oceanic crust, and are newer rocks than the blue or pink stripes further from the ridge.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What type of boundary is characterized by plates sliding past each other?
Back
Transform boundary.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How can you determine the oldest island in a chain of islands formed by a hot spot?
Back
By considering the latitude/longitude of the hot spot, the direction the plate moves, and how far the island is from the hot spot.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a divergent boundary?
Back
A boundary where two tectonic plates move away from each other, often creating new oceanic crust.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a convergent boundary?
Back
A boundary where two tectonic plates move towards each other, often resulting in one plate being forced below another.
